There are two mountains called Shaviklde in Georgia

  • at an elevation of 3,578 m, at 42°15′14"N 45°37′9"E, at the border to Dagestan

  • at an elevation of 2,850 meters, the highest peak of the Trialeti Range

    Trialeti Range is an east-west mountain range of the Lesser Caucasus Mountains in the central part of Georgia.
